MADISON — When the Environmental Protection Agency last week released new guidelines for how much PFAS should be allowed in public drinking water systems, it left officials in Mosinee concerned.  The city of 4,500 in northern Wisconsin knows it has elevated levels of at least one PFAS chemical — PFOS —in its public water system. But while that contamination amount is now above federal recommendations, it remains well below state standards. 'The city is concerned whether there is currently technology available to reduce PFAS to the EPA's proposed standards and the significant cost,' said Mosinee City Administrator Jeff Gates in an email.
